Leading

adj.capable, energeticprofessional

What it means

Holding a notably important, advanced, or influential position.

Reach for it when describing a person or organization with credible standing in its field

A leading accessibility researcher reviewed the station design.

Choose between these

7
  • everyday

    top

    brief informal praise suits a clear high performer

    not when Top can imply number one when the evidence only supports membership in a strong group.

  • warm

    respected

    earned regard is safer than a ranking claim

    not when Respected is modest when measurable field leadership matters.

  • professional

    influential

    the subject shapes decisions or practice

    not when Influential does not necessarily mean skilled, ethical, or advanced.

  • professional

    pioneering

    original work opened a new path

    not when Pioneering concerns novelty, not present leadership in the field.

  • professional

    prominent

    visibility and influence are more certain than rank

    not when Prominent may reflect fame without excellence.

  • formal

    foremost

    the subject has a defensible claim to the highest standing

    not when Foremost is stronger than leading and needs exceptional evidence.

  • literary

    preeminent

    singular distinction is both intended and supportable

    not when Preeminent is inflated for one of several respected contributors.
